Abstract
Graphene Oxide (GO) shows remarkable properties in many filed like electronics, sensors, biomedical, thermal conductivity, nanofluids, etc. In this paper, to manufacture GO the original hummer's method was employed. To confirm the transformation of carbon into GO, several characterization methodologies including FESEM, FTIR, RAMAN, EDS, and XRD were employed. GO suspension at different concentrations composed with the help of exhaustive ultrasonication suspension of GO in double distilled water. After one week, UV-Vis spectroscopy was used to examine the stability and the DLS technique was used to confirm the presence of GO in the suspension and the nanoparticle size of GO in the suspension. To calculate the acoustical parameter of the prepared samples ultrasonic velocity, density and viscosity were measured with the help of instruments available. Further, these values were employed to compute parameters like adiabatic compressibility, attenuation, acoustical impedance, etc. Acoustical thermal properties of the prepared sample of Water-GO suspension are reported in this paper.
